Câu hỏi phỏng vấn Redis
Câu hỏi

Pipelining trong Redis là ...

Câu trả lời

Pipelining trong Redis là một kỹ thuật cho phép gửi nhiều lệnh tới server mà không cần phải chờ đợi kết quả của từng lệnh một. Điều này giúp tăng hiệu suất bằng cách giảm độ trễ trong việc giao tiếp giữa ứng dụng và server Redis. Khi sử dụng pipelining, các lệnh được đưa vào hàng đợi và sau đó được thực thi một cách tuần tự mà không cần phải chờ đợi phản hồi cho mỗi lệnh, giúp tối ưu hóa thời gian xử lý và tăng tốc độ thực thi các lệnh[1].

Pipelining nên được sử dụng khi bạn cần gửi nhiều câu lệnh tới Redis server trong một yêu cầu duy nhất. Điều này thường hữu ích trong các tình huống cần thực hiện nhiều thao tác cập nhật hoặc truy vấn dữ liệu mà không cần...

senior

senior

Gợi ý câu hỏi phỏng vấn

senior

Làm thế nào để lưu trữ JSON một cách hiệu quả trong Redis?

expert

Redis nhanh hơn MongoDB bao nhiêu?

senior

Tại sao Redis không hỗ trợ khôi phục?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ào